Big Four Powerhouses: Global Reach Meets Local Insight
The Big Four—Deloitte, PwC, EY, and KPMG—retain a dominant presence in the UAE’s auditing landscape. These firms bring unmatched resources, global methodologies, and sophisticated audit technology. Their local offices in Dubai and Abu Dhabi offer sector-specific teams who are well-versed in UAE tax laws, ESR, and economic zone compliance. For large enterprises, publicly listed companies, and multinational subsidiaries, their services are often indispensable.

Yet, they may not be the ideal fit for every business. Their fees are premium, and smaller companies may find more personalized attention with mid-tier firms that offer equivalent technical depth.


Mid-Tier Firms Making a Regional Impact
Firms such as Grant Thornton, BDO UAE, and Crowe UAE strike a balance between global standards and local accessibility. With strong affiliations to international networks, they provide high-level audit and advisory services tailored to regional dynamics. Their partners often maintain hands-on involvement in engagements, which enhances accountability and turnaround time.

For businesses seeking specialized audits—such as internal audits, forensic services, or risk assurance—these firms offer strong capabilities without the bureaucracy of a larger entity.


Specialized UAE-Based Firms on the Rise
Local firms like NUFCA, HLB HAMT, and Jaxa Chartered Accountants are quickly gaining prominence due to their responsiveness, cost-effectiveness, and understanding of UAE’s shifting legal framework. They offer robust solutions for SMEs, startups, and family-owned businesses operating in both Free Zones and the Mainland.

These audit firms stand out for their agility. They can often deliver quicker audit cycles, flexible pricing structures, and ongoing consultation, making them attractive for companies looking for a partner rather than just a service provider.

Industry-Specific Audit Expertise
Different sectors have different financial reporting needs. For example, real estate developers must comply with escrow account regulations; healthcare providers need to report insurance receivables meticulously; and fintech startups must undergo IT audits to meet licensing requirements.

Top firms align teams by industry to ensure sector-specific understanding. This vertical specialization results in fewer errors, faster audits, and more meaningful recommendations.

What Businesses Should Consider Before Choosing an Audit Partner
Every business has different needs. A startup in Dubai Silicon Oasis may not require the same audit depth as a multinational based in DIFC. When selecting an auditor, consider the firm’s experience in your jurisdiction, their approach to partner involvement, fee transparency, and ability to provide year-round advisory—not just year-end reports.

Also, check whether they are listed with UAE’s Ministry of Economy or your relevant Free Zone authority. This ensures your audit will be accepted for license renewals, visa quotas, and government tenders.
